'Baahubali' Is Conquering The Box-Office In India And Abroad

Baahubali: The Beginning is most definitely not in any danger of breaking director S.S. Rajamouli's unbroken streak of back-to-back hits. His larger-than-life mythological epic has garnered glowing reviews for its scale, visual effects, and battle scenes (read our review here).

While its final worldwide numbers are yet to be confirmed, an India Today report suggests that the Prabhas starrer has raked in a staggering Rs 160 crore at the box-office worldwide, in just three days.

On Saturday, it became the fastest Indian film to cross the Rs 100 mark worldwide, as per a tweet by trade analyst Sreedhar Pillai.




Meanwhile, according to Bollywood trade pundit Taran Adarsh, the film's dubbed Hindi version alone has made Rs 22.35 crore over the weekend.




Reportedly India's most expensive movie ever, Baahubali: The Beginning has sparked unprecedented fan frenzy, leading to a record opening day collection of Rs 50 crore. It is not showing any signs of slowing down either.
